Waves of infrared radiation are longer than waves of visible light, so ordinary digital cameras don't see them, and neither do the eyes of human beings. Although invisible to the eye, longer infrared radiation can be detected as warmth by the skin.
That's a key idea to why WISE will be able to see things other telescopes can't. Not everything in the universe shows up in visible light. Asteroids, for example, are giant rocks that float through space — but they absorb most of the light that reaches them. They don't reflect light, so they're difficult to see. But they do give off infrared radiation, so an infrared telescope like WISE will be able to produce images of them. During its mission WISE will take pictures of hundreds of thousands of asteroids.
Brown dwarfs8 are another kind of deep-space object that will show up in WISE's pictures. These objects are “failed” stars — which means they are not massive enough to jump start9 the same kind of reactions that power stars such as the sun. Instead, brown dwarfs simply shrink and cool down. They're so dim that they're almost impossible to see with visible light, but in the infrared spectrum they glow.
